General Purpose of Job:
Provide a wide variety of routine and advanced forms of respiratory therapy procedures for the diagnosis, treatment, and care of patients with respiratory dysfunction.

General Requirements • Registered Respiratory Therapist: Credentialed by the National Board for Respiratory care. • Licensed by the State of Michigan. • Current BCLS Certification. • Preferred- ACC Certification or NPS Certification from NBRC. Work Experience • 1 year of critical care experience in a hospital setting (preferred) Education • High school diploma or GED. • Graduate from a Respiratory Therapy school that is credentialed by the National Board of Respiratory Care. Specialized Knowledge and Skills • Demonstrates the ability to work on a team. • Able to demonstrate the knowledge and skill necessary to provide care based on physical, psycho/social, educational, safety and related criteria, appropriate to the age of the patients serviced in his/her assigned service are as related to the principle duties and responsibilities of the position. The skills and knowledge needed to provide such care may be gained through education, training or experience.
